Friday, July 11, 2025 @ LCO Food Distribution - 9026 Round Lake School Road, Hayward, WI 54843 Each box will contain proteins, produce, and shelf-stable items, sourced from Indigenous and non-Indigenous local producers and will be representative of traditional foods whenever possible. The average box will be 20 pounds. The contents of the boxes will change for each distribution based on what is available seasonally for the given distribution week. PLEASE NOTE: Food provided is for Tribal members, 55 years and older. This project is funded by an Intertribal Local Food Purchasing Assistance grant and funding awarded through the Wisconsin Biennial Budget. The project is coordinated by the Great Lakes Intertribal Food Coalition in partnership with Feeding America Eastern Wisconsin.
